Located in the heart of the Jewish quarter, opposite the mosque, this restaurant is committed to the typical gastronomy of the region. Enjoy the bar area for informal tapas, the lounge or their beautiful cobbled inner courtyard for a more leisurely meal. On the menu, you'll find mazamorra (a traditional dish made of almonds, bread, garlic, oil and vinegar) served with Pedro Ximénez jelly, Sephardic honey lamb, sautéed baby squid and tuna in mojito sauce. A diverse offering where flavour and tradition take precedence. The restaurant has several other venues in the city. A must-try to experience Cordoba through its cuisine.
